Editorial Review for Rocksport Bar & Grill – by Citysearch Editors

In Short
Rocksport's gigantic projection screen is ideal for big sports, and with another 14 TVs scattered about the bar fed by DirecTV, fans catch every play. The spacious floor has enough seating for small groups and large crowds. Bar stools are in abundance and patrons watch the constant flow from their 16 beer taps, with a changing selection every month. The menu features very competent pub grub, and there's live music most Saturday nights.
